Podcast Episode: Camden Milk Bar History

The content explores Camden's unique architectural and dairy history, focusing on a Tudor-style milk bar built in 1939 to promote Camden Vale special milk. It highlights the building's role in public health, its creative design by Cyril Ruwald, and its transformation into a boutique hotel, connecting local heritage with modern branding.

Camden Show 2026: Family Fun and Agricultural Excellence

The Camden Show, established in 1886, is an annual community festival celebrating agriculture, local talent, and heritage in the Macarthur region. Attracting over 48,000 visitors, it features livestock exhibitions, competitions, and entertainment. The event fosters community spirit, showcasing historical traditions and engaging volunteers dedicated to promoting agriculture and youth involvement.
